Git Product home page Git Product logo

kredikartbasvuru's Introduction

Mobil Programlama Dersi Dönem Projesi

Kredi Kartı Başvuru Uygulaması

Proje Paydaşları

  • Ali Erdem Akın - 120202001

  • Melike Yücel - 130202034

  • Büşra Nur Altıntaş - 130202027

  • Begüm Aydın - 130202065

  • Bengü Aydın - 130202066

  • Münevver Turan - 120202081

Uygulamanın Özeti

Kredi kartı başvurusu yapmak isteyen bir kullanıcı kişisel bilgilerini girerek işlemi onaylar. Daha sonra web servisle kişinin maaş ve yaş kontrolü yapılır ve başvurusunun kabul sonucu kullanıcıya gösterilir. Böyle bir senaryoya sahip projemizde kullanılan component ve özellikler aşağıdaki gibidir.

  • Tablet ve telefonlarda hem yatay hem de dikey olarak çalışacak şekilde LAYOUT tasarımlarının yapıldı.

  • Layoutlar ve ScroolView kullanıldı.

  • Scroll View, Progressbar, CheckBox, List View, Radio Button, AuotoComplete TextView componentleri kullanıldı.

  • Activity Yasam Döngüsü kullanıldı.

  • Intent kullanıldı.

  • Bundle kullanıldı.

  • Shared Preferences kullanıldı.

  • Thread kullanıldı.

  • AsyncTask kullanıldı.

  • Soap Web Servis kullanıldı.

  • OneSignal Push Notification kullanıldı.

1) Splash Screen

splash

2) AuotoComplete TextView

AutoComplate

3) Radio Button ve CheckBox

RadioAndCheck

4) Ana Ekran

main

5) ProgressBar

ProgressBar

6) Web Service Sonucu

Burada butona tıklandığı zaman soap web servise bir önceki aktivity ekranında aldığımız maaş ve doğum günü değişkenleri kullanılarak web servise maaş ve yaş değişkenleri gönderiliyor. Gönderilen bu değişkenlerden dönen sonuç bir önceki ekranda alınan isim değişkeni ile birlikte ekrana yazılıyor.

WebService

7)Push Ekranı

Konsoldan push gönderildiğinde,kullanıcının telefonunda bildirim çubuğunda gözükmekte, buna tıklanıldığında ise başlık ve içerik kullanıcıya gösterilmektedir.

Push Ekranı

kredikartbasvuru's People

Contributors

erdemakin avatar munevverturn avatar bsrnr avatar mlkeycel08 avatar bngydn avatar bgmydn avatar

Watchers

James Cloos avatar Okan YÜKSEL av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.